The Supreme Court on Thursday extended the term of the Director of the Directorate of Enforcement (ED) SK Mishra till September 15 in “larger public interest.”
His term was to end on July 31 as per the July 11 judgment which held the previous extensions given to the officer to be illegal.
The Union government argued that Mishra’s presence was necessary for the ongoing evaluation by the Financial Action Task Force (FATF).
Mishra is in his fifth year as ED Director.
